Duct tape, also known synonymously as duck tape, is known for its many uses. These days, the motto seems to be "if it's broke duct tape can fix it." Many people abide by this motto, using duct tape for a variety of purposes such as to tape up windows, as material for dresses, and to remove warts.
There are three major types of duct tape that are available today. The most common type is the silver or gray colored tape. Other less common types include transparent and 3M adhesive tape. All of these kinds of duck tape have specific uses.
Silver is the first kind of duct tape to be invented. It was used in the military and even acquired a nickname, the 100 mph tape, due to its ability to maintain its adhesive in 100 mph winds. Silver tape is normally used for household problems such as leaky pipes, broken windows, and automotive repair. Other uncommon uses include clothing creations, accessory creations, and padding drums. In recent years, silver tape has become available in multiple colors such as lime green, red, yellow, and blue.
Transparent duct tape is a subset of the original. Transparent tape is known to last 6 times longer than silver tape, is easier to tear, and works well in extreme heat and UV conditions. It's also widely praised for it visibility, or rather, lack thereof. Transparent duct tape can be purchased at a variety of hardware stores including Ace Hardware and Menards, and is available in different thicknesses and lengths.
3M adhesive tape is the most advanced form of duct tape. It is lightweight, durable, and is said to have a stronger adhesive. Unlike other forms, 3M adhesive tape is used for less conventional projects. For instance, 3M adhesive tape has a double sided version. This is generally used to keep dresses and clothes from falling off and exposing people. It is durable enough and soft enough to stick to cloth without damaging it. It's also light weight enough that it doesn't weigh down the wearer.
All the different types of duck tape can be purchased at hardware stores including Ace Hardware and Menards, and large chain stores such as Target and Wal-Mart. The most common length is 1.88 in by 20 yards, and the most common brands are Scotch and Grangier. It can be purchased for approximately $5-$10, and a duck tape dispenser can also be purchased at these stores for as little as $4.
